Water softener installation services involve the setup of specialized systems designed to treat hard water, which contains high levels of minerals such as calcium and magnesium. These systems are typically installed at the point where the main water supply enters a property, ensuring that the entire household or commercial space benefits from softened water. The installation process includes connecting the unit to the plumbing system, ensuring proper placement and secure fittings, and configuring the system to operate efficiently. Professional installers assess the property’s water usage and flow rate to select the appropriate type and size of water softener, facilitating optimal performance and longevity.
One of the primary issues addressed by water softener installation is the presence of hard water, which can cause a range of problems in residential and commercial properties. Hard water often leads to mineral buildup in pipes, appliances, and fixtures, resulting in reduced efficiency and increased maintenance costs. It can also cause soap scum, dull laundry, and dry skin, impacting daily comfort and cleanliness. Installing a water softener helps mitigate these issues by removing or reducing mineral content, thereby protecting plumbing systems, extending the lifespan of appliances, and improving water quality for household or business use.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a water softener ranges from $1,500 to $3,500, depending on the system type and home size. Some projects may fall below or above this range based on specific needs and conditions.
System Pricing - Basic models can start around $600, while more advanced or larger capacity units may cost up to $4,000 or more.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to individual home requirements.
Additional Expenses - Installation may include costs for plumbing modifications or upgrades, which can add $200 to $1,000 to the total. These expenses vary based on existing plumbing and property layout.
Service Fees - Service providers often charge between $100 and $300 for installation visits, with prices influenced by system complexity and local market rates. Contact local pros for precise quotes based on specific installation need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a water softener? Installation typically includes connecting the unit to the main water line, ensuring proper flow and drainage, and configuring settings for optimal performance. It is recommended to have a professional handle the process for proper setup and safety.
How long does water softener installation usually take? The installation process generally takes a few hours, depending on the complexity of the plumbing and the type of system being installed. A local service provider can provide a more specific estimate based on the property.
Is water softener installation disruptive to household water supply? When performed by a professional, installation is usually quick and minimizes disruption to household water. Some temporary water shutoff may be necessary during the process.
Can a water softener be installed in any home? Most homes with a standard water supply can have a water softener installed. A local contractor can assess the existing plumbing and advise on the best placement for the system.
What should be considered before installing a water softener? Factors include water usage, water hardness level, and available space for the unit. Consulting with a local professional can help determine the appropriate system size and placement.
